First Ever Virtual Open House for Student Clubs and Teams

Camilla Brinkman

It’s been a year of firsts on many fronts.

One of them was the first ever virtual Open House for Edgerton Center Clubs and Teams. Planned by the students, 14 teams participated and about 80 first year students showed up. On Zoom.

The event provided an opportunity to introduce the Class of 2025 to the teams – Rocket Team, Engineers Without Borders, Hyperloop, Battlebots, and more. Teams displayed images of their projects, answered questions, and encouraged new students to engage in what for many of the students, encapsulates a hands-on engineering education, a source of community, and even the chance to help each other with P-sets. 

In another first, a two-minute video made to feature all of the teams was crafted by Jade Chongsathapornpong and Aditya Mehrota from the MIT Solar Electric Vehicle Team and Summer Hoss and Lili Sun from the MIT Rocket Team.
